Red flags hoisted at several beaches

The Leisure and Cultural Services Department announced today (June 16) that according to the Beach Water Quality Forecast System of the Environmental Protection Department (www.epd.gov.hk/epd/english/environmentinhk/water/beach_quality/forecast_system.html), the Beach Water Quality Forecast Index for Deep Water Bay Beach and Big Wave Bay Beach in Southern District, Hong Kong Island; Silver Mine Bay Beach and Pui O Beach in Islands District; Silverstrand Beach and Clear Water Bay Second Beach in Sai Kung District; Kadoorie Beach in Tuen Mun District; Lido Beach, Casam Beach and Ting Kau Beach in Tsuen Wan District; and Tai Po Lung Mei Beach in Tai Po District is 4, which means the predicted water quality at these beaches is "Very Poor" due to potential transient water quality fluctuations caused by heavy rain. Red flags have been hoisted, and beachgoers are advised not to enter the water to safeguard their health.
